May 29, 1978
Honorable Steny H. Hoyer
President of the Senate
State House
Annapolis, Maryland 21404

Dear Mr. President:

In accordance with Article II, Section 17 of the
Maryland Constitution, I have today vetoed Senate Bill 169.

This bill includes certain persons within the class of
individuals whose petitions for emergency admission to
mental health facilities shall be reviewed within certain
time periods.

Senate Bill 905, which was enacted by the General
Assembly and signed by me on May 16, 1978, generally revises
the provisions relating to these emergency admissions and,
in doing so, accomplishes the purpose of Senate Bill 169.

In addition, the provisions of Senate Bill 169 are, to
some extent, inconsistent with portions of the larger
revision bill. The sponsor agrees that both measures should
not be signed and has therefore requested that I veto Senate
Bill 169.

For these reasons, I have decided to veto Senate Bill
169.

Sincerely,
Blair Lee III
Acting Governor
